Leader Education is seeking a compassionate and dedicated Autism Support Worker to join a welcoming SEND school in Ashington. This is an excellent opportunity for someone who is passionate about making a positive difference in the lives of young people with autism and additional needs.

This role is Monday-Friday 8:30-3:30

About the Role

As an Autism Support Worker, you will:

  • Provide one-to-one and small-group support to pupils with autism.
  • Help create a safe, structured, and engaging learning environment.
  • Support the development of communication, social skills, and independence.
  • Work closely with teachers, SENCOs, and other support staff to tailor support to individual needs.
  • Promote inclusion and ensure every child has the opportunity to succeed.

What We’re Looking For

  • Experience supporting children or young people with autism (school or care setting).
  • A patient, empathetic, and resilient approach.
  • Strong communication and teamwork skills.
  • A genuine passion for supporting SEND students.
  • Enhanced DBS on the update service (or willingness to obtain one).
